New Bottomfishing Regs Considered for Hawaiian Islands
Hawaii’s Department of Land and Natural Resources, Division of Aquatic Resources is considering regulation of bottomfishing, including non-commercial bottomfishing, to address concerns of overfishing.
According to the news release, "The Department proposes to amend Hawaii Administrative Rule Chapter 13-74, License and Permit Provisions and Fees for Fishing, Fish and Fish Products, to require fishing reports…
Radiation Detectors for Ports on Hold
The Washington Post said that the Department of Homeland Security’s project to procure and install 1,700 radiation detectors at ports or other points of entry has been postponed, here. This delay is projected to last until next year.
This effort is one of many post-9/11 measures to enhance the security of the nation’s ports. …

Trust Territory Revisited – Compacts Updated by Congress
The Compacts of Free Association had a comprehensive update recently passed by the U.S. House of Representatives. This amendment was sent to the Senate last week, here. These Compacts affect the countries of the Federated States of Micronesia, the Republic of the Marshall Islands and the Republic of Palau.
